The Content Materials Of Modern Constitution In Indonesian Kingdom’s Acts

Irham Rosyidi, I Nyoman Nurjaya, Rahmat Safa’at, Jazim Hamidi

Abstract


The achievement of Indonesia’s national purpose, which is creating a fair and prosperous society, really needs national spirit in form of value, norm, and formulation model on traditional costitution law norm in Nusantara. Efforts of exploration and development on the value and formulation model of traditional constitutional law in Nusantara must be done with confident and creativity by all nation’s descents. The historical-jurisdicial fact reveals that traditional constitutional law in Nusantara possesses modern constitutional contents, including the limitation on the power of the nation’s leader, civil’s rights, state’s organizations or institutions, the procedur in composing groundnorm/constitution, and independent judicial institution. All those contents in modern constitution are clearly and completely arranged as law principles which characterize with understoodable language, describes the bad impact of inhonesty, uses examples, gives hard punishment, has open formulation norm, and nd its law norm is flexible for changes.
